Quinta dos aciprestes
Grande Reserva Sousão

A powerful red that assembles all the characteristics of this famed varietal allied to the Quinta dos Aciprestes terroir. This variety has been present in the region for many years but very rarely used as a single varietal wine. We believe this wine will transmit yet another style of Douro as well as our passion to discover the singularities of each grape.

Winemaking

100% Sousão, in a very special selection from the only parcel of Sousão at Quinta dos Aciprestes. A grape characterized by it’s intense colour and high acidity. Sousão enjoys stainless steel fermentation while ageing occurs in partially new and used french oak barriques.

TASTING NOTES

Reveals the essence of Sousão through a very deep and profound tint colour, typical of this famed variety. Hints of green combine with fine fruit aromas and classic Sousão tertiary notes of spice and coffee grain, offering immense aromatic complexity. Flavourful, yet smooth on the palate, with vivid yet round tannins and finally characterised but a very lively acidity, which again is typical in Sousão.
